Syria and Israel to Sign Security Agreement with US Mediation

Independent Arabia reports that Syria and Israel are set to sign a security agreement mediated by the United States, coinciding with Ahmad al-Shara's visit to New York for the UN General Assembly.

Kokcha News Agency: According to Syrian officials cited by Independent Arabia, a security agreement between Syria and Israel, mediated by the United States, is scheduled to be signed during Ahmad al-Shara’s presence in New York for the UN General Assembly meeting.

The report states that al-Shara will deliver a speech at the General Assembly on October 2nd, and the security agreement will be finalized and signed on October 3rd.

Informed sources emphasize that this agreement is designed to reduce tensions between Damascus and Tel Aviv and is not a “comprehensive peace agreement” in nature
